Method of producing a fibrous web containing natural and synthetic fibres
The present invention relates to a method of manufacturing a fibre web which includes a fibre matrix that is comprised of natural fibres and possibly synthetic fibres. According to the present method, an aqueous, planar fibre layer is prepared from the natural fibres and possible synthetic fibres, which layer comprises an aqueous phase and a fibrous phase, and which layer is dried in order to remove the aqueous phase, in which case the natural fibres and possible synthetic fibres together form a fibre matrix. According to the present invention, binder is applied onto the water-containing fibre layer, which binder is allowed to penetrate via the aqueous phase at least partially in between the fibres, before the hydrogen bonds between the fibres form. With the present invention, it is possible to manufacture such cellulose or lignocellulose-based fibre products which have plastic-like properties, such as good fracture toughness, tear resistance and stretching.
Web of cellulosic fibers comprising an active agent and method for manufacturing a web of cellulosic fibers comprising an active agent
A web including cellulosic fibers having two sides and including an additive composition present on at least one side of the web and a method of making such a web are disclosed. The additive composition includes at least one filming agent and at least one active agent, the filming agent being fixed on the web and the active agent being retained on the web by the filming agent, the active agent being an antimicrobial agent.

Fibrous sheet with improved properties
A method for producing a foam-formed multilayered substrate that includes producing an aqueous-based foam including at least 3% by weight non-straight synthetic binder fibers, wherein the non-straight synthetic binder fibers have an average length greater than 2 mm; forming together a wet sheet layer from the aqueous-based foam and a cellulosic fiber layer, wherein the cellulosic fiber layer includes at least 60 percent by weight cellulosic fibers; and drying the combined layers to obtain the foam-formed multilayer substrate. A multilayered substrate includes a first layer including at least 60 percent by weight non-straight synthetic binder fibers having an average length greater than 2 mm; and a second layer including at least 60 percent by weight cellulosic fiber, wherein the first layer is in a facing relationship with the second layer, and wherein the multilayered substrate has a wet/dry tensile ratio of at least 60%.

TISSUE PRODUCT MADE USING LASER ENGRAVED STRUCTURING BELT
A tissue product including a laminate of at least two plies of a multi-layer tissue web, the tissue product having a softness value (HF) of 92.0 or greater, a lint value of 4.5 or less, and an Sdr of greater than 3.0.

Treated wood material
The present disclosure describes a treated cellulosic material comprising: a cellulosic material having a porous structure defining a plurality of pores, at least a portion of the pores containing a treating agent comprising: a polymer comprising an olefin-carboxylic acid copolymer; and a modifying agent comprising a quat.
